With 193 pieces, the LEGO Rey's Speeder (75099) is a neat little set. It launched in 2015 under the Star Wars banner at $19.99. The set includes 2 minifigures, adding play and display value.
You're looking at $0.104 per piece, which holds up well against other Star Wars sets.
